American Traveler is seeking a travel nurse RN ICU - Intensive Care Unit for a travel nursing job in Columbus, Georgia. Job Description & Requirements • Specialty: ICU - Intensive Care Unit, • Discipline: RN, • Start Date: 05/11/2026, • Duration: 12 weeks, • 36 hours per week, • Shift: 12 hours, nights, • Employment Type: Travel Assignment Overview • Shift: Nights, 3x12hrs, • Hours: 36 hrs/wk, • Start Date: May 11, 2026, • Length: 12 weeks, • Hospital ICU setting serving an adult to geriatric patient population, • High-acuity unit with a wide range of ICU diagnoses, including a high volume of ventilated patients and arterial lines (A-lines), • Patient ratio of 1:2–3, • Night shift, 3x12-hour shifts (19:00–07:00), • Every other weekend required, • Floating within the facility and to a sister campus within scope of practice as needed, • No on-call requirements, • Uses Epic (required), Pyxis, and SBAR communication framework, • Navy blue scrubs requiredRequirements, • Active GA or compact RN license required, • Current BLS and ACLS certifications required, • Minimum 2 years of ICU experience required, • Proficiency with Epic EMR required, • Experience with titration of continuous infusions including sedation agents, pain medications, paralytic agents, and vasopressors required, • Competency on the Baxter PrisMax machine required to care for CRRT patientsAdditional Information, • First-time travelers are welcome to apply, • Local candidates are accepted, • RTO maximum of 7 days; RTO cannot be requested during the first week of the assignment, • If one or two major holidays fall within the assignment period, the traveler is expected to work all of them with no holiday RTO permitted; if three major holidays fall within the assignment period, the traveler is expected to work two of them, • Major holidays include: Memorial Day, Independence Day, Labor Day, Thanksgiving/Black Friday (counts as 1), Christmas Eve/Christmas Day (counts as 1), and New Year's Eve/New Year's Day (counts as 1), • Travelers must be away from all Piedmont facilities for a full year before returning as a traveler, • Multidisciplinary morning rounds include the intensivist, bedside RN, PharmD, RRT, OT/PT, dietitian, case manager, and wound care, • Patient transport (e.g., to CT) is performed by the bedside RN, tech, and RRT if the patient is on a ventilator, • Night shift NPs place central lines, vascaths, and A-lines, attend all codes, manage ICU care issues, and admit patients from the ED to the ICU — they serve as first call before the intensivist With thousands of travel nursing and allied jobs nationwide, our attentive and approachable recruiters find positions that align perfectly with your career aspirations and personal requirements.
